Detailed Description
The invention will be further described with reference to the accompanying drawings:
as shown in figure 1, bent axle skeleton oil blanket mounting tool, including support 1, kicking block 2 and fastener 4, support 1 middle part sets up centre bore 3, and the periphery of centre bore 3 distributes and has the slot of different diameters, and the inslot distributes and has the mounting hole, and kicking block 2 passes through fastener 4 and the mounting hole and installs at the ditch inslot. The support 1 is of a cross structure and comprises a transverse plate and a vertical plate which are perpendicular to each other, and the grooves in the transverse plate and the vertical plate, which correspond to the top block 2, are of arc structures. The bracket 1 is an integrated structure. The length of the top block 2 is longer than the width of the transverse plate and the vertical plate at the positions of the top block. Gaps are arranged between the adjacent top blocks 2. The top blocks 2 with the same diameter have the same specification. The fastener 4 is set as a bolt, the bolt is arranged at the joint of the bolt and the top block 2, and the end face of the bolt is lower than that of the top block 2. So that the top block 2 can play a positioning role.
When the device is used, the size of the installed framework oil seal is determined firstly, and the top block 2 with the corresponding size is installed on the support 1. After the installation is finished, the framework oil seal is placed near the top block 2 and between the support 1 and the framework oil seal installation hole, and then the support 1 passes through
Figure BDA0002406833860000024
The reamed hole bolt is fixed on the crankshaft central hole 3. And the framework oil seal is extruded into the framework oil seal mounting hole by screwing up the reaming hole bolt. When the framework oil seal is to be threaded into an inlet, the framework oil seal can be assisted by hands through the gap between the adjacent top blocks 2, so that the distance between the framework oil seal and the mounting hole is not too far. After the threading inlet is removed, only the hinged hole bolt needs to be screwed, and the framework oil seal is naturally installed.

Claims (6)

1. The utility model provides a bent axle skeleton oil blanket mounting tool which characterized in that: the support comprises a support (1), a top block (2) and a fastening piece (4), wherein a center hole (3) is formed in the middle of the support (1), grooves with different diameters are distributed in the periphery of the center hole (3), mounting holes are distributed in the grooves, and the top block (2) is mounted in the grooves through the fastening piece (4) and the mounting holes.
2. The crankshaft framework oil seal installation tool of claim 1, wherein: the support (1) is of a cross structure and comprises a transverse plate and a vertical plate which are perpendicular to each other, and the grooves in the top block (2) corresponding to the transverse plate and the vertical plate are of arc structures.
3. The crankshaft framework oil seal installation tool of claim 2, wherein: the length of the top block (2) is longer than the width of the transverse plate and the vertical plate at the positions of the top block.
4. The crankshaft framework oil seal installation tool of claim 2, wherein: gaps are arranged between the adjacent top blocks (2).
5. The crankshaft framework oil seal installation tool of claim 2, wherein: the top blocks (2) with the same diameter have the same specification.
6. The crankshaft framework oil seal installation tool of claim 1, wherein: the fastener (4) is arranged as a bolt, the bolt is arranged at the joint of the bolt and the top block (2), and the end face of the bolt is lower than that of the top block (2).
